SUMMER SQUASH AND ZUCCHINI SIDE DISH



Summer Squash and Zucchini Side Dish image

I'm trying to cut my risk for cardiac disease by changing the way I eat. This colorful sauteed zucchini and squash side dish is packed with as much nutrition as fresh-picked flavor! -Marlene Agnelly, Ocean Springs, Mississippi

Time 30m

Yield 6 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 10

1 yellow summer squash, quartered and sliced
1 medium zucchini, quartered and sliced
1 medium onion, chopped
1 medium sweet red pepper, cut into 1-inch pieces
1 tablespoon olive oil
2 garlic cloves, minced
1/2 teaspoon salt-free spicy seasoning blend
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/8 teaspoon pepper
1 medium tomato, chopped

Steps:

  • In a large skillet, saute the yellow squash, zucchini, onion and red pepper in oil for 5 minutes. Add garlic and seasonings; saute 2-3 minutes longer or until vegetables are crisp-tender. Stir in tomato; heat through.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 53 calories, Fat 2g fat (0 saturated fat), Cholesterol 0 cholesterol, Sodium 104mg sodium, Carbohydrate 8g carbohydrate (4g sugars, Fiber 2g fiber), Protein 2g protein. Diabetic Exchanges

POTLUCK SUMMER SQUASH AND ZUCCHINI SIDE DISH



Potluck Summer Squash and Zucchini Side Dish image

This colorful side dish is perfect for a potluck and a great way to use up your summer bounty of tomatoes and squash. The mild seasoning lets the garden-fresh flavor of the tender vegetables shine through.-Jen Stutts, Florence, Alabama

Time 25m

Yield 12 servings (2/3 cup each).

Number Of Ingredients 8

3 medium yellow summer squash, sliced
3 medium zucchini, sliced
1 medium red onion, chopped
2 tablespoons olive oil
1-1/2 cups sliced fresh mushrooms
1 medium tomato, cut into wedges
2 garlic cloves, minced
Salt and pepper to taste

Steps:

  • In a large skillet, saute the squash, zucchini and onion in oil until crisp-tender. Add the mushrooms, tomato and garlic, saute 4-5 minutes longer. Season with salt and pepper.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 44 calories, Fat 2g fat (0 saturated fat), Cholesterol 0 cholesterol, Sodium 7mg sodium, Carbohydrate 5g carbohydrate (3g sugars, Fiber 1g fiber), Protein 2g protein. Diabetic Exchanges
